I Know An Old Lady (Matryoshka Dolls)

Acrylic and marker on wood matryoshka dolls, winter 2007/2008

This is a set of Russian nesting dolls painted in the song of “I know an old lady”, in reverse order (ie. from fly to horse) so that the song can be sung using the dolls as they are revealed one-by-one. For those that have forgotten the song…
